I built a home with Level in Ascension Parish about 6 years ago.
Pro - they offer alot of nice options as standards (granite counter tops, glass backsplashes, etc.) and also offer alot of upgrade options.
Cons - alot of their sub contractors did "sloppy work" - the attention to detail wasn't there on a number of items. Also, their "customer service" after the sale (that they pride themselves on) is horrendous....they don't stand behind their "warranty".
Would I build with them again? Honestly, probably not.
